    Description

    The City University of New York, on behalf of Queens College (“College”) seeks to procure, through a Request For Quote (RFQ), a Hewlett Packard computers and Apple Mini’s with respective warranties, apple care and accessories for student labs, faculty and administrative staff pursuant to Request for Quotes (RFQ) No. 212533952. Pursuant to its discretionary authority under the New York State Education Law and State Finance Law, this procurement opportunity is limited to businesses certified pursuant to Articles 15-A (MWBE) and/or 17-B (SDVOB) of the New York State Executive Law. Any purchase that results from this advertisement shall be governed by the terms and conditions of this advertisement (including without limitation, any attached specifications and any terms and conditions attached hereto or incorporated herein by reference), the University's standard Purchase Order Terms and Conditions, and the Standard Clauses for New York State Contracts which are incorporated herein by reference with the same effect as it is written. These documents are available for review upon request to the contact listed below. Communication with the University with respect to this procurement initiated by or on behalf of an interested vendor through others may constitute an "impermissible contact" under State law, and could result in disqualification of that vendor. The College reserves the right to request financial information, and references for projects of similar size, scope, and complexity completed within the past two years from the Bid Submission Date. Any purchase that results from this advertisement shall be governed by the University’s standard Terms and Conditions, the resulting Purchase Order, and the Standard Clauses for New York State Contracts (Appendix A). The restricted period has begun with the publication of this advertisement. Prospective bidders may request a copy of the RFQ via email from the Designated Contact listed below. No site visit is required for this RFQ. Contact with CUNY: Under the requirements of the Procurement Lobbying Act (PLA), all communications regarding advertised projects are to be channeled through the Designated Contact. Communication with respect to this procurement initiated by or on behalf of an interested vendor through others than the Designated Contact may constitute an “impermissible contact” under NYS law and could result in disqualification of that vendor. Compliance with the PLA: Required Forms: Vendor shall complete, sign and submit the following forms if they are selected. “Offerer’s Affirmation of Understanding of and Agreement pursuant to State Finance Law § 139-j (3) and § 139-j (6) (b)” “Offerer’s Disclosure of Prior Non-Responsibility Determinations and Certification of Compliance with State Finance Law §139-j and §139-k” For rules and regulations, and more information on the PLA, please visit: https://ogs.ny.gov/acpl (Advisory Council FAQs) https://jcope.ny.gov/lobbying-laws-and-regulations (New York State Lobbying Act) Business enterprises awarded an identical or substantially similar procurement contract within the past five years: NONE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Business (SDVOB) SDVOB Goal: 100.00% Minority / Women Business Enterprise contracting goals (MWBE) Total MWBE Goals: 100.00% Disadvantaged Business Enterprise contracting goals (DBE) DBE Goal: 0.00%
